Why Beach Weddings Require Unique Guest Dress Styles
The beach offers soft golden light, drifting waves, and warm colors—elements that call for guest attire that feels both chic and breezy. Forget rigid formal wear that taxes movement; today’s beach wedding guests should feel free to laugh, walk, dance, and savor the moment without constraint. The best guest dresses strike a balance between sophistication and comfort, incorporating lightweight fabrics, flowing lines, and colors that complement sea and sand tones.
1. Maxi Dresses with Boho Flair

Boho-chic has become synonymous with beach weddings, and for good reason: maxi dresses in flowy silks, chiffon, or linen deliver a romantic, effortless vibe perfect for sunlit sand. Look for loose, floor-length styles adorned with delicate lace, ruffles, or tassel embellishments. Earthy terracotta, soft peach, ocean blue, and sandy beige are standout hues—colors that merge with the beach palette.

2. Sheer, Minimalist Silhouettes
For guests who prefer understated elegance, sheer layering pieces are a must-have. Light, opaque tulle or organza overlays dance in the ocean breeze, creating a ghostly, dreamy effect when paired with solid base top or midi skirts. Opt for subtle round necklines or off-the-shoulder details to preserve poise without sacrificing femininity. Neutral tones with metallic or muted floral prints deliver timeless grace.

3. Colorful Shift Dresses with Artisanal Touches
Bright, artisanal prints and vibrant hues elevate the beach aesthetic beyond beige and white. Flared shift dresses in coral, turquoise, or sunset orange add joy and energy. Look for hand-embroidered details, crochet accents, or hand-painted patterns that echo coastal artistry. These dresses couldn’t shine brighter than mere guest attire—they’re wearable storytelling.
Best for: Guests who love bold colors and want to embody the beach’s vibrant spirit.

Impossibly flattering and easy to wear, wrap dresses are ideal for beach weddings where comfort meets glamour. Lightweight jersey or cotton-linen blends, cinched at the natural waist with satin orvo straps, flatter every shape while encouraging ease of movement. Shorter lengths (knee to mid-calf) balance modesty with breeziness, layered with sheer kimonos or lightweight sarongs for a romantic touch.
